Medtronic reports further growth in Q2 2015
Medtronic has expressed satisfaction with its financial performance for the second quarter of its 2015 fiscal year, which ended on October 24th 2014.
During the three months, the company's worldwide second-quarter revenue total came to $4.37 billion (2.78 billion pounds), up by four percent on a reported basis. This strong performance was well-balanced across its various businesses and geographic territories.
Recent product launches and initiatives helped its restorative therapies, cardiac and vascular, and diabetes groups all achieve year-on-year growth. The company now expects revenue growth in the range of four to five percent on a constant currency basis for the full year.
The firm is also on track to complete its takeover of Covidien early during the 2015 calendar year, a move that will significantly expand its capabilities.
Omar Ishrak, Medtronic's chairman and chief executive officer, said: "Revenue growth was at the upper end of our full-year revenue outlook and within our mid-single digit baseline goal, reflecting the strong execution of our global organisation."
The $42.9 billion deal to acquire Covidien was agreed in June 2014 and will create one of the world's biggest medical technology and services businesses.
